100% Sauvignon Blanc sourced from a single vineyard owned by the Sowman family on the fertile, free-draining soils of Marlborough's lower Wairau Valley.
Fruit was pressed off immediately following harvesting to minimise skin contact and juice deterioration. After settling the juice was fermented using a selected yeast strain in stainless steel at cool temperatures to retain fruit flavour and freshness. This batch was selected as a Pioneer Block wine due to its power and intensity of flavour.
Winemaker's Comments
On the nose, aromatic white currant and fragrant tropical fruit with a hint of cut grass. The palate shows luscious ripe grapefruit and green guava flavours. Deliciously textural and slightly chalky in mouthfeel with a long lingering finish.
